UNITED STATES

Senate Committee approves measure to end restrictions on travel to Cuba

Yesterday July 23, with the support of 14 Democrats and four Republicans, the Senate Appropriations Committee approved an amendment to the proposed 2016 government budget to relax restrictions on travel to Cuba, and allow increased trade between the two countries.

Cuba battling to eradicate malaria  in Africa

LUANDA (PL).—As is the case with Nigeria, Equatorial Guinea and Gabon, Cuba is collaborating with Angola in combating vectors such as mosquitoes, the carriers of malaria and dengue, among other diseases.
